PRIMARY JOB RESPONSIBITIES
Schedule patients focusing on patient safety and reducing the likelihood of medical/health care errors
Maintain clean, organized, professional work area, and performs other related duties as assigned
Assist in orientating and training new patient services specialist staff
Schedule new, return, and procedure appointments and coordinate and schedule ancillary appointments
Create Epic orders and referrals for scheduling radiology exams to include exam specific CPT and ICD-10 codes, complete patient registration needs by creating and updating demographics, guarantor accounts, and insurance payors
Participate in process improvement projects such as facilitating workgroup efforts to identify and increase daily throughput of Epic work queue orders
Work towards departmental and team goals by analyzing Epic work queue orders and assist in workflow efficiency enhancements
Participate in use case improvement for the processing of external provider orders through the Fax document management application to be scheduled in Epic
Skilled in identifying and driving solutions for the anesthesia and sedation nurse triage coordinationAct as a subject matter expert for their scheduling modality, think critically, and troubleshoot Epic errors for the team
Function proficiently within their team to assist with the training of new staff and act as a go to team resource
Support their team Lead in day-to-day operational goals
Assist in monitoring Epic schedule templates to ensure the group is performing proper resource level loading
Audit online ticket scheduling appointments for accuracy of order placement, referral completion, and resource selection
Analyze the No Show, Cancellation, Wait list follow up reports data, and the Online Scheduling reports to perform patient follow up and reduce revenue loss
Develop and maintain good working relationships within the department, with other departments and all medical staff
Other duties assigned

ABOUT UW MEDICAL CENTER-MONTLAKE
UW Medical Center is an acute care academic medical center located in Seattle with two campuses: Montlake and Northwest. As the No. 1 hospital in Seattle and Washington State since 2012 (U.S. News & World Report) and nationally ranked in seven specialties, UW Medical Center prides itself on compassionate patient care as well as its pioneering medical advances.
The UW Medical Center-Montlake campus is located on the edge of the beautiful UW campus which includes many amenities available to our staff as well as very convenient public transit options including the Sound Transit’s light rail station across the street.
